    So in Generation IV, we saw two evil teams arise. One had already had the experience of being villains while the others were brand new to a brand new region. We have Team Rocket and Team Galactic, both who have endless dreams of domination and abducting Pokemon. Team Rocket has stuck around longer, since the very beginning and their plot is to steal Pokemon off the innocent.

    Team Galactic's plot however is far deeper. Cyrus's goal was summoning Dialga and Palkia in order to destroy the universe so that he may start it again as its god, ultimately to create a world without spirit.

    Battle-wise, they both had a fair appearance of the same Pokemon. Team Rocket used Pokemon such as Rattatas and Zubats along with Koffings while Galactic had common appearances of Glameows, Puruglys and Stunkys. Who did you think was a harder challenge to face, whether it be the grunts or the big cheeses? (the commanders.)

    Which one of these teams did you like better, and why?
